Copyright 2024 HNCloud Limited.
香港联合通讯国际有限公司
怎么解决linux ftp 530的问题?
时间 : 2024-03-11 17:41:18
编辑 : 华纳云
阅读量 : 258
在Linux中遇到FTP 530错误通常表示登录失败。这可能是由于多种原因导致的,以下是一些常见的解决方法:
1. 检查用户名和密码:
确保您输入的用户名和密码是正确的。注意用户名和密码区分大小写。
2. 检查FTP服务器配置:
检查FTP服务器配置文件(通常是 /etc/vsftpd.conf)以确保允许不实名或普通用户登录,并且没有明确禁止您尝试登录的用户。
3. 检查用户权限:
确保您尝试登录的用户具有访问FTP服务器的权限。您可以检查用户的权限以及所属组,以确保其具有足够的权限访问FTP服务器。
4. 检查FTP服务器状态:
确保FTP服务器正在运行,并且没有被防火墙或其他网络安全措施阻止了FTP连接。您可以使用 systemctl status vsftpd 命令检查FTP服务器的状态,并根据需要重新启动FTP服务器。
5. 检查FTP客户端配置:
如果您使用的是FTP客户端软件,确保您已正确配置了FTP客户端,包括服务器地址、端口、传输模式等信息。有时候配置不正确也会导致登录失败。
6. 检查被动模式配置:
如果您的FTP服务器配置了被动模式(Passive Mode),请确保服务器端口范围已在防火墙中打开,并且FTP服务器已正确配置以使用被动模式。
7. 检查日志文件:
检查FTP服务器的日志文件(通常是 /var/log/vsftpd.log 或 /var/log/messages)以获取更多信息。日志文件可能会记录登录失败的原因,有助于诊断问题。
根据您的具体情况,逐步检查并尝试上述解决方法,通常可以解决FTP 530登录问题。如果问题仍然存在,请检查其他可能的问题,或者查阅相关文档或社区资源以获取更多帮助。
上一篇:常见的服务器异常原因和解决方法
下一篇:Linux如何显示文件完整路径?